{"id":92,"date":"2025-06-26T15:05:51","date_gmt":"2025-06-26T15:05:51","guid":{"rendered":"https:\/\/spotifypremiumapk.tr\/news\/?p=92"},"modified":"2025-06-26T15:05:51","modified_gmt":"2025-06-26T15:05:51","slug":"behind-the-scenes-how-online-games-are-developed","status":"publish","type":"post","link":"https:\/\/spotifypremiumapk.tr\/news\/behind-the-scenes-how-online-games-are-developed\/","title":{"rendered":"Behind the Scenes: How Online Games Are Developed"},"content":{"rendered":"<p><span style=\"font-weight: 400;\">Online games have become an integral part of modern entertainment. From simple multiplayer puzzles to massive online battle arenas (MOBAs) and expansive role-playing games (MMORPGs), the complexity and scope of these games have increased dramatically. But behind every online game is a vast and intricate development process that involves hundreds\u2014sometimes thousands\u2014of creative and technical professionals working together.<\/span><\/p>\n<p><span style=\"font-weight: 400;\">In this article, we\u2019ll explore the behind-the-scenes <\/span><a href=\"https:\/\/brevardrealty.net\/\" target=\"_blank\" rel=\"noopener\"><span style=\"font-weight: 400;\">Pedetogel<\/span><\/a><span style=\"font-weight: 400;\"> of online game development, shedding light on how these digital worlds come to life\u2014from concept to launch, and beyond.<\/span><\/p>\n<h2><b>1. The Concept and Pre-production Phase<\/b><\/h2>\n<p><span style=\"font-weight: 400;\">Every game starts with an idea. This could stem from a desire to tell a specific story, explore a gameplay mechanic, or tap into a trending genre. The pre-production phase is where these ideas are fleshed out into a workable concept.<\/span><\/p>\n<p><span style=\"font-weight: 400;\">Game designers, writers, and producers collaborate to define the core gameplay loop (the main activity players will repeat), the game\u2019s objectives, storylines, characters, and world setting. At this stage, teams also consider the business model\u2014will it be free-to-play with in-game purchases, a subscription service, or a one-time purchase?<\/span><\/p>\n<p><span style=\"font-weight: 400;\">A game design document (GDD) is usually created to guide the team. This comprehensive blueprint outlines the vision, features, mechanics, and narrative elements of the game. Technical feasibility, budget, and timeline estimates are also developed during this phase.<\/span><\/p>\n<h2><b>2. Building the Team<\/b><\/h2>\n<p><span style=\"font-weight: 400;\">Once the game enters active development, studios assemble a team with a range of skills. Key roles in online game development typically include:<\/span><\/p>\n<ul>\n<li style=\"font-weight: 400;\" aria-level=\"1\"><b>Game Designers<\/b><span style=\"font-weight: 400;\">: Define gameplay mechanics and user experience.<\/span><span style=\"font-weight: 400;\">\n<p><\/span><\/li>\n<li style=\"font-weight: 400;\" aria-level=\"1\"><b>Programmers<\/b><span style=\"font-weight: 400;\">: Write the code that brings everything to life, including networking logic for online play.<\/span><span style=\"font-weight: 400;\">\n<p><\/span><\/li>\n<li style=\"font-weight: 400;\" aria-level=\"1\"><b>Artists and Animators<\/b><span style=\"font-weight: 400;\">: Create character models, environments, textures, and visual effects.<\/span><span style=\"font-weight: 400;\">\n<p><\/span><\/li>\n<li style=\"font-weight: 400;\" aria-level=\"1\"><b>Sound Designers and Composers<\/b><span style=\"font-weight: 400;\">: Craft the audio experience, including sound effects and music.<\/span><span style=\"font-weight: 400;\">\n<p><\/span><\/li>\n<li style=\"font-weight: 400;\" aria-level=\"1\"><b>Writers<\/b><span style=\"font-weight: 400;\">: Develop dialogue, lore, and story arcs.<\/span><span style=\"font-weight: 400;\">\n<p><\/span><\/li>\n<li style=\"font-weight: 400;\" aria-level=\"1\"><b>QA Testers<\/b><span style=\"font-weight: 400;\">: Identify bugs and ensure the game works as intended.<\/span><span style=\"font-weight: 400;\">\n<p><\/span><\/li>\n<li style=\"font-weight: 400;\" aria-level=\"1\"><b>Network Engineers<\/b><span style=\"font-weight: 400;\">: Ensure online components like matchmaking, lobbies, and servers function correctly.<\/span><span style=\"font-weight: 400;\">\n<p><\/span><\/li>\n<\/ul>\n<p><span style=\"font-weight: 400;\">Collaboration across these disciplines is essential. Developers use project management tools like Jira or Trello, and communication platforms like Slack or Discord, to keep everything coordinated.<\/span><\/p>\n<h2><b>3. Prototyping and Early Development<\/b><\/h2>\n<p><span style=\"font-weight: 400;\">Before building the full game, developers often create prototypes. These are simplified versions of the game used to test mechanics and concepts. For instance, in a multiplayer shooter, a prototype might focus solely on movement and shooting to evaluate how fun and responsive those core mechanics are.<\/span><\/p>\n<p><span style=\"font-weight: 400;\">This phase is vital for reducing risk. A concept that looks good on paper may not translate well into actual gameplay. Prototyping allows teams to identify issues early and pivot if necessary.<\/span><\/p>\n<h2><b>4. Full Production: Art, Code, and Content<\/b><\/h2>\n<p><span style=\"font-weight: 400;\">Once the prototype is validated, full production begins. This is the longest and most resource-intensive phase.<\/span><\/p>\n<ul>\n<li style=\"font-weight: 400;\" aria-level=\"1\"><b>Art and Animation<\/b><span style=\"font-weight: 400;\">: Artists begin creating high-quality models, textures, and animations. For online games, particular attention is given to optimizing these assets to ensure performance across various devices.<\/span><span style=\"font-weight: 400;\">\n<p><\/span><\/li>\n<li style=\"font-weight: 400;\" aria-level=\"1\"><b>World Building<\/b><span style=\"font-weight: 400;\">: Level designers craft maps and environments. They use tools like Unity, Unreal Engine, or proprietary engines to create immersive worlds that balance aesthetic appeal and gameplay functionality.<\/span><span style=\"font-weight: 400;\">\n<p><\/span><\/li>\n<li style=\"font-weight: 400;\" aria-level=\"1\"><b>Programming and Systems<\/b><span style=\"font-weight: 400;\">: Developers build game systems\u2014combat, inventory, progression, physics, and artificial intelligence. Online features such as matchmaking, chat, and multiplayer lobbies are also programmed.<\/span><span style=\"font-weight: 400;\">\n<p><\/span><\/li>\n<li style=\"font-weight: 400;\" aria-level=\"1\"><b>Multiplayer Infrastructure<\/b><span style=\"font-weight: 400;\">: Online games require reliable networking. Developers implement client-server architectures or peer-to-peer systems. Dedicated servers are common in competitive games to ensure fairness and reduce latency. Load balancing, security, and data synchronization are crucial challenges.<\/span><span style=\"font-weight: 400;\">\n<p><\/span><\/li>\n<li style=\"font-weight: 400;\" aria-level=\"1\"><b>Live Testing<\/b><span style=\"font-weight: 400;\">: Alpha and beta testing are used to get feedback and identify issues. Players are invited to test the game before release, helping to uncover bugs, balance problems, and user experience flaws.<\/span><span style=\"font-weight: 400;\">\n<p><\/span><\/li>\n<\/ul>\n<h2><b>5. The Role of Backend and Cloud Services<\/b><\/h2>\n<p><span style=\"font-weight: 400;\">Behind every <\/span><a href=\"https:\/\/macauindo.co\/\" target=\"_blank\" rel=\"noopener\"><span style=\"font-weight: 400;\">Macauindo<\/span><\/a><span style=\"font-weight: 400;\"> game is a powerful backend infrastructure that supports millions of concurrent players. Game developers partner with cloud service providers like Amazon Web Services (AWS), Microsoft Azure, or Google Cloud to host their servers and manage player data.<\/span><\/p>\n<p><span style=\"font-weight: 400;\">Key backend features include:<\/span><\/p>\n<ul>\n<li style=\"font-weight: 400;\" aria-level=\"1\"><b>Authentication<\/b><span style=\"font-weight: 400;\">: Managing player accounts and logins.<\/span><span style=\"font-weight: 400;\">\n<p><\/span><\/li>\n<li style=\"font-weight: 400;\" aria-level=\"1\"><b>Matchmaking<\/b><span style=\"font-weight: 400;\">: Pairing players of similar skill levels.<\/span><span style=\"font-weight: 400;\">\n<p><\/span><\/li>\n<li style=\"font-weight: 400;\" aria-level=\"1\"><b>Data Storage<\/b><span style=\"font-weight: 400;\">: Saving player progress, purchases, and stats.<\/span><span style=\"font-weight: 400;\">\n<p><\/span><\/li>\n<li style=\"font-weight: 400;\" aria-level=\"1\"><b>Live Operations<\/b><span style=\"font-weight: 400;\">: Delivering updates, seasonal events, and in-game purchases.<\/span><span style=\"font-weight: 400;\">\n<p><\/span><\/li>\n<\/ul>\n<p><span style=\"font-weight: 400;\">Server stability, uptime, and security are top priorities. Downtime can lead to frustrated players and lost revenue, especially in competitive or time-sensitive games.<\/span><\/p>\n<h2><b>6. Quality Assurance and Testing<\/b><\/h2>\n<p><span style=\"font-weight: 400;\">Quality assurance (QA) is a continuous process throughout development, but it becomes especially intense toward the end of production. QA teams test every aspect of the game:<\/span><\/p>\n<ul>\n<li style=\"font-weight: 400;\" aria-level=\"1\"><b>Functionality Testing<\/b><span style=\"font-weight: 400;\">: Ensures core mechanics work correctly.<\/span><span style=\"font-weight: 400;\">\n<p><\/span><\/li>\n<li style=\"font-weight: 400;\" aria-level=\"1\"><b>Network Testing<\/b><span style=\"font-weight: 400;\">: Examines how the game performs under different network conditions.<\/span><span style=\"font-weight: 400;\">\n<p><\/span><\/li>\n<li style=\"font-weight: 400;\" aria-level=\"1\"><b>Security Testing<\/b><span style=\"font-weight: 400;\">: Identifies vulnerabilities to prevent cheating and exploits.<\/span><span style=\"font-weight: 400;\">\n<p><\/span><\/li>\n<li style=\"font-weight: 400;\" aria-level=\"1\"><b>Cross-platform Testing<\/b><span style=\"font-weight: 400;\">: Confirms the game works on different devices and operating systems.<\/span><span style=\"font-weight: 400;\">\n<p><\/span><\/li>\n<\/ul>\n<p><span style=\"font-weight: 400;\">Bugs and balance issues discovered during testing are logged and prioritized for fixing before release.<\/span><\/p>\n<h2><b>7. Launch and Post-Launch Support<\/b><\/h2>\n<p><span style=\"font-weight: 400;\">A game&#8217;s launch is a major milestone, but it&#8217;s far from the end of development\u2014especially for online games.<\/span><\/p>\n<ul>\n<li style=\"font-weight: 400;\" aria-level=\"1\"><b>Live Operations (LiveOps)<\/b><span style=\"font-weight: 400;\">: After launch, developers continuously update the game with new content, seasonal events, balance patches, and technical improvements.<\/span><span style=\"font-weight: 400;\">\n<p><\/span><\/li>\n<li style=\"font-weight: 400;\" aria-level=\"1\"><b>Community Management<\/b><span style=\"font-weight: 400;\">: Engaging with the player base is critical. Studios use forums, social media, and in-game tools to listen to feedback and foster a loyal community.<\/span><span style=\"font-weight: 400;\">\n<p><\/span><\/li>\n<li style=\"font-weight: 400;\" aria-level=\"1\"><b>Analytics<\/b><span style=\"font-weight: 400;\">: Developers monitor gameplay data to understand player behavior, detect issues, and inform design changes. A\/B testing is common to evaluate changes before full rollout.<\/span><span style=\"font-weight: 400;\">\n<p><\/span><\/li>\n<li style=\"font-weight: 400;\" aria-level=\"1\"><b>Monetization<\/b><span style=\"font-weight: 400;\">: For free-to-play games, ongoing revenue often comes from cosmetic items, battle passes, and premium content. Ethical monetization practices are essential to maintain trust with players.<\/span><span style=\"font-weight: 400;\">\n<p><\/span><\/li>\n<\/ul>\n<h2><b>8. Challenges and Trends in Online Game Development<\/b><\/h2>\n<p><span style=\"font-weight: 400;\">The field of online game development is fast-paced and full of challenges:<\/span><\/p>\n<ul>\n<li style=\"font-weight: 400;\" aria-level=\"1\"><b>Cheating and Hacking<\/b><span style=\"font-weight: 400;\">: Maintaining fair play is a constant battle.<\/span><span style=\"font-weight: 400;\">\n<p><\/span><\/li>\n<li style=\"font-weight: 400;\" aria-level=\"1\"><b>Server Load and Scaling<\/b><span style=\"font-weight: 400;\">: Anticipating player traffic spikes (e.g., after a major update) is vital.<\/span><span style=\"font-weight: 400;\">\n<p><\/span><\/li>\n<li style=\"font-weight: 400;\" aria-level=\"1\"><b>Crossplay and Cross-save<\/b><span style=\"font-weight: 400;\">: Increasingly, players expect to play with friends across platforms and save progress across devices.<\/span><span style=\"font-weight: 400;\">\n<p><\/span><\/li>\n<li style=\"font-weight: 400;\" aria-level=\"1\"><b>AI and Procedural Generation<\/b><span style=\"font-weight: 400;\">: AI is being used to generate content and test gameplay at scale.<\/span><span style=\"font-weight: 400;\">\n<p><\/span><\/li>\n<li style=\"font-weight: 400;\" aria-level=\"1\"><b>Player Retention<\/b><span style=\"font-weight: 400;\">: Games as a service (GaaS) require developers to keep players engaged for months or even years.<\/span><span style=\"font-weight: 400;\">\n<p><\/span><\/li>\n<\/ul>\n<h2><b>Conclusion<\/b><\/h2>\n<p><span style=\"font-weight: 400;\">Creating an online game is a massive undertaking that blends creativity, technology, and teamwork. From the initial spark of an idea to the ongoing management of a live service, every phase involves countless hours of work and problem-solving.<\/span><\/p>\n<p><span style=\"font-weight: 400;\">The next time you log into your favorite online game, remember the army of developers working behind the scenes to make your digital adventures possible. It&#8217;s not just a game\u2014it&#8217;s a living, breathing world, built and maintained by a dedicated team of dreamers and doers.<\/span><\/p>\n","protected":false},"excerpt":{"rendered":"<p>Online games have become an integral part of modern entertainment. From simple multiplayer puzzles to massive online battle arenas (MOBAs) and expansive role-playing games (MMORPGs), the complexity and scope of these games have increased dramatically. But behind every online game is a vast and intricate development process that involves hundreds\u2014sometimes thousands\u2014of creative and technical professionals &#8230; <a title=\"Behind the Scenes: How Online Games Are Developed\" class=\"read-more\" href=\"https:\/\/spotifypremiumapk.tr\/news\/behind-the-scenes-how-online-games-are-developed\/\" aria-label=\"Read more about Behind the Scenes: How Online Games Are Developed\">Read more<\/a><\/p>\n","protected":false},"author":29,"featured_media":93,"comment_status":"open","ping_status":"open","sticky":false,"template":"","format":"standard","meta":{"footnotes":""},"categories":[9],"tags":[],"class_list":["post-92","post","type-post","status-publish","format-standard","has-post-thumbnail","hentry","category-sports"],"_links":{"self":[{"href":"https:\/\/spotifypremiumapk.tr\/news\/wp-json\/wp\/v2\/posts\/92","targetHints":{"allow":["GET"]}}],"collection":[{"href":"https:\/\/spotifypremiumapk.tr\/news\/wp-json\/wp\/v2\/posts"}],"about":[{"href":"https:\/\/spotifypremiumapk.tr\/news\/wp-json\/wp\/v2\/types\/post"}],"author":[{"embeddable":true,"href":"https:\/\/spotifypremiumapk.tr\/news\/wp-json\/wp\/v2\/users\/29"}],"replies":[{"embeddable":true,"href":"https:\/\/spotifypremiumapk.tr\/news\/wp-json\/wp\/v2\/comments?post=92"}],"version-history":[{"count":2,"href":"https:\/\/spotifypremiumapk.tr\/news\/wp-json\/wp\/v2\/posts\/92\/revisions"}],"predecessor-version":[{"id":95,"href":"https:\/\/spotifypremiumapk.tr\/news\/wp-json\/wp\/v2\/posts\/92\/revisions\/95"}],"wp:featuredmedia":[{"embeddable":true,"href":"https:\/\/spotifypremiumapk.tr\/news\/wp-json\/wp\/v2\/media\/93"}],"wp:attachment":[{"href":"https:\/\/spotifypremiumapk.tr\/news\/wp-json\/wp\/v2\/media?parent=92"}],"wp:term":[{"taxonomy":"category","embeddable":true,"href":"https:\/\/spotifypremiumapk.tr\/news\/wp-json\/wp\/v2\/categories?post=92"},{"taxonomy":"post_tag","embeddable":true,"href":"https:\/\/spotifypremiumapk.tr\/news\/wp-json\/wp\/v2\/tags?post=92"}],"curies":[{"name":"wp","href":"https:\/\/api.w.org\/{rel}","templated":true}]}}